CentOS Stream 8 是 Red Hat Enterprise Linux (RHEL) 8 的上游公共开发分支,将于 2024 年结束迭代更新补丁。以下是关于 CentOS Stream 8 的一些最佳实践:
安装与配置
- 使用 nmcli 进行网络配置:CentOS 8 已废弃 network.service,网卡操作需要使用 nmcli 工具。详细展示了如何配置单个和多个 IPv4 地址,包括静态配置、网关设置,以及如何批量配置 IPv6 地址。
- 在 VMware 中配置 CentOS Stream 8:包括修改虚拟机的网络设置,设置静态 IP 地址,以及确保网络服务正确启动。
系统维护
- 系统更新与升级:使用 DNF 作为包管理器进行系统更新和升级,注意备份重要数据。
- 安全加固:考虑使用安全加固脚本,例如在公众号中回复【centos8安全加固】关键字留言获取。
性能优化
- 网络配置优化:根据实际情况调整网络参数,如调整 TCP/IP 栈参数,优化网络缓冲区大小等。
- 磁盘 I/O 优化:使用 SSD 替代 HDD,调整文件系统参数,如 noatime,使用数据日志等。
安全性考虑
- 防火墙配置:使用 firewalld 或 nftables 进行精细化的防火墙配置,保护系统免受未授权访问。
- 定期安全审计:定期检查系统漏洞,使用工具如 OpenVAS 进行安全扫描。
迁移与兼容性
- 迁移建议:由于 CentOS Stream 8 将于 2024 年结束支持,建议评估迁移到其他发行版,如 RHEL 或 Ubuntu,以确保系统的长期稳定性和安全性。
以上实践基于当前的技术和社区信息,随着 CentOS Stream 的迭代更新,具体实践可能会有所变化。